With Leopard introducing Grade 2 Contracted Braille throughout the OS, and Safari being an important part of that, WebKit needs to have a default stylesheet specifying which elements do not get contracted (e.g. dt, code, var, etc.) Since contraction depends on content language, we'd need to fix the language inheritance before WebKit + Braille is usable to anyone. http://www.w3.org/WAI/GL/WCAG20/WD-WCAG20-TECHS/ http://www.w3.org/WAI/PF/braillecss.html
